'Tips'에 해당되는 글 3

  1. 2007/01/11 낭만곰팅 Google Blogger 사용자 정의 도메인 지원
  2. 2007/01/05 낭만곰팅 HTML Source Editing Performance Improvements in VS 2005 SP1
  3. 2006/12/15 낭만곰팅 Snap Preview Anywhere 팁

Google Blogger 사용자 정의 도메인 지원

Tips | 2007/01/11 09:34 | 낭만곰팅
지난 연말에는 Blogger의 새 버전(New Blogger)이 beta 딱지를 떼더니 이제는 사용자 정의 도메인(Custom Domain)을 지원한다고 한다.
즉 hijava4.blogspot.com이 아니라 blogspot.hijava.net 처럼 본인 소유의 도메인으로 서비스가 가능하다는 말이다.
사용자 삽입 이미지

블로거 도움말에 나온 것 처럼 우선은 DNS에 Blogger를 서비스 할 CNAME 레코드를 추가한다.
도움말에는 ghs.google.com을 CNAME으로 추가하라고 했지만 nslookup을 해서 해당 아이피를 추가했다.(DNS 설정 화면 참조)

 

이제 Google Blogger의 관리 메뉴에서 "설정" > "게시" 메뉴로 이동해서 "사용자 정의 도메인"을 선택하고 DNS에 추가한 도메인을 입력하고 설정을 저장한다.

사용자 삽입 이미지


게시 방법을 바꾸고 이전에 사용하던 도메인으로 접속하면 새로 추가한 도메인으로 자동으로 포워딩 된다.

Blogger 새 버전에는 많은 기능들이 추가되었고 사용법도 예전 Blogger보다 많이 개선되었다.
하지만 이전의 FTP나 SFTP를 이용한 게시를 사용하기 위해서는 클래식 템플릿을 사용해야만 한다.
이 두가지 방법의 장단점은 이삼구님"구글 블로거를 내 도메인으로"에 잘 나와있다.
2007/01/11 09:34 2007/01/11 09:34
지난 12/15에 Visual Studio Service Pack1(이하 VS2005 SP1)에 나왔는데 연말이라는 핑계로 미루다가 오늘 설치를 했다.
용량이 400MB가 넘고 설치 이전에 설정을 체크하는데 오래 걸려서 그런지 설치 시간이 굉장히 오래 걸린다는 생각이 든다.
구쓰리 아저씨(Scott Guthrie)가 얘기하길 VS2005 SP1를 설치만 해도 HTML Source Editing시에 퍼포먼스를 향상시켜 준다고 한다.

첫째, HTML Validation feature의 퍼포먼스가 튜닝되어서 큰 문서의 Validation도 빨라졌다고 한다. (관련내용 더보기)

둘째, 기존의 경우 성능 향상을 위해 HTML Editor의 Validation 항목을 disable(Show Errors 체크 해제) 하더라도, 작업중에 Validation Error가 있는 상태에서 Design 모드로 전환을 하게 되면 "Error List"에 error를 보여주기 위해 이 옵션이 자동으로 다시 enable 되었다. 에러를 알려주는 것은 좋지만 사용자에게 알려주지 않고 옵션이 자동으로 enable되어서 매번 다시 disable시켜하는 것은 매우 귀찮은 일이였다. VS2005 SP1은 이부분을 해결해서 disable된 상태에서 Validation Erorr를 있으면 이를 알려주기만 할뿐 옵션을 다시 enable시키지는 않는다.

셋째, 기타 HTML Options에 Source view에서 Property Grid에 대한 옵션("Enable property grid in Source view")이 추가되었다.
Source view 모드에서도 소스 수정을 하면 Property Grid가 계속 갱신이 되지만, 이 옵션을 끄면 더이상 Source view 모드에서 property grid에 값이 나오지 않는다.
기본적으로 VS2005 SP1를 설치하면 HTML Source View 모드에서 Grid View는 disable된 상태이다.
이 기능을 잘 사용하지 않거나(개인적으로 직접 고치는걸 선호한다면), 시스템 사양이 좋지 않다면 상당한 효과를 얻을 수 있다고 한다.

사용자 삽입 이미지

주로 Eclipse(Aptana plug-in), Vim, VS2005, SciTE 를 같이 쓰는데 VS가 무겁다는 생각이 들어서 HTML 관련 작업을 할때는 잘 쓰지 않았지만 성능이 많이 향상이 되었다고 하니 구쓰리 아저씨를 믿고 애용해 줘야 겠다.

출처 : HTML Source Editing Performance Improvements in VS 2005 SP1
2007/01/05 11:37 2007/01/05 11:37

Snap Preview Anywhere 팁

Tips | 2006/12/15 09:58 | 낭만곰팅
팔글님 블로그를 보다 Snap Preview Anywhere를 알게 되었다.
편리해 보이긴 하는데 역시나 너무 많은 곳에 Preview Popup이 뜨는건 너무 산만해 보일것 같아서 방법을 찾아보기로 했다.

혹시나 하는 맘으로 FAQ를 찾아보니 역시나  추가 속성이 잘 정리되어 있다. :)
3단계의 간단한 절차를 거치면 블로그에 삽입할 다음과 같은 코드가 생성된다.

<script defer="defer" id="snap_preview_anywhere" type="text/javascript"
  src="http://spa.snap.com/snap_preview_anywhere.js?ap=1&sb=1&
  key=8657cb7db7ec3a512be9b72e6a8aa5c4&
  domain=hijava.tistory.com"></script>
  1. Preview Popup에 나오는 search box제거 하기
    위의 Javascript code의 'sb=1' 을 'sb=0' 으로 바꾸면 search box가 사라진다.

  2. 특정한 링크에만 preview 팝업이 나오지 않게 하기
    preview popup이 필요없는 링크에 "snap_nopreview" class 속성을 준다.
    <a href="http://feeds.feedburner.com/hijava" class="snap_nopreview">

  3. 원하는 링크만 preview 팝업이 나오게 하기
    이럴 경우에는 우선 'ap=1' 파라미터를 'ap=0'으로 바꾸어 준다.
    그리고 원하는 링크에 "snap_preview" class를 설정한다.
    <a class="snap_preview" href="http://www.example.com">
    www.example.com</a>
Snap Preview Anywhere FAQ 보기
2006/12/15 09:58 2006/12/15 09:58